Al Ahly secured an important 2-1 victory over Zamalek in the match held tonight, Monday, at Cairo Stadium as part of the ninth round of the Premier League. Substitute Hussein El-Shahat played a major role in Al Ahly’s win by scoring a goal and causing a penalty kick from which Trezeguet scored the second goal.
Zamalek took the lead through Hossam Abdel Meguid in the 32nd minute from a penalty kick, while Al Ahly’s goals came from Hussein El-Shahat in the 71st minute and Trezeguet in the 78th minute from a penalty.
